Northwest Neighborhood Summary

Northwest has earned the nickname of “Nob Hill” after the famous neighborhood in San Francisco. Northwest throws densely populated residential areas alongside hoppin’ retail and restaurant districts to create a distinct vibe all its own. NW 23rd Avenue is the place to go during the day, with lovely upscale shops and cafes, as well as the famous music retailer Music Millennium. NW 21st Avenue is the hot spot at night, with a number of different restaurants, bars, clubs, and an indie movie theater. All of these booming business districts stand in stark contrast to the lovely historic buildings of the Alphabet District. Residential options vary dramatically. You can find anything from newer apartments to older single-family homes. Regardless, you can guarantee that you’ll be located close to the hustle and bustle of Northwest’s prevalent business districts. This neighborhood is an attractive option for both young professionals and students, as it’s located close to Downtown, PSU, and OHSU.

Methodology

Each month, using over 1 million Rentable listings across the United States, we calculate the median 1-bedroom and 2-bedroom rent prices by city, state, and nation, and track the month-over-month percent change. To avoid small sample sizes, we restrict the analysis for our reports to cities meeting minimum population and property count thresholds.
